Summary
The feather Process operator controls the cooking process from hydrolyzing the raw feathers to a finished product.. Operates straight or articulated rubber tired tractor type vehicle equipped with front mounted hydraulically powered bucket or scoop to lift and transport bulk materials to and from storage processing areas, to feed cookers, hoppers, or chutes. 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following:

Hydrolyzing raw feathers.
Drying the raw feathers.
Sizing.
Running the Machinery that processes the cooked feathers into make feather meal.
Transferring of hydrolyzed feather meal to storage.
Starts engine, shifts gears, presses pedals, and turns steering wheel to operate loader.
Moves levers to lower and tilt bucket and drives front end loader forward to force bucket into bulk material.
Moves levers to raise and tilt bucket when filled, drives vehicle at work site, and moves levers to dump material.
Performs routine maintenance on loader such as lubricating, fueling, and cleaning.
Fills Feather Cooker’s and tightens the domes to ensure the materials cooks correctly.
